A look back at the evolution of my style in 2013 and the lessons I’ve learned:

– Summer is not my favorite season to get dressed.
– Do you no matter what the occasion.
– Invest in pieces you know you’ll wear forever.
– Ebay is legit!
– I binge shop denim.
– Think about every purchase. If you’re hesitant, the answer is no.
– I like a very edited closet. I’m all about selling the things I don’t wear.
– Black is my new favorite color. It’s just so VERSATILE.
– If you’re petite, your seamstress is everything.
– When something fits well (which is rare), get it in as many colors as possible.
– One word to describe my style: Comfortable. One word to describe my closet: Versatile.
